摘要

Pyrroxamide lsqb;N-(1-hydroxymethyl-2,3,dihydroxypropyl)-2,2,5,5-tetramethyl pyrrolidine-l-oxyl-3-carboxyamidersqb; is a newly tested nonionic monomeric nitroxyl compound with demonstrated effectiveness for MRI contrast enhancement at doses as low as 10-3M. Pyrroxamide and its hydroxylamine metabolic derivative were tested in concentrations from 10-9to 10-2M with a battery of cytotoxic and mutagenic assays using mammalian Chinese hamster ovary cells. Loci-specific mutation induction was examined at the hypoxanthine-guanine phosphoribosyltransferase (HGPRT) and the Naplus;sol;Kplus; ATPase loci, both in the presence and absence of a liver microsomal metabolic activating mixture (S-9 mix). Cell survival and induction of sister chromatid exchanges also were studied. All tests yielded negative results indicating that pyrroxamide and and hydroxylamine derivative were both noncytotoxic and nonmutagenic at the doses tested.
